• 
    

    
    

      99热精品在线国产_美女午夜性视频免费_国产精品国产高清国产av_av欧美777_自拍偷自拍亚洲精品老妇_亚洲熟女精品中文字幕_www日本黄色视频网_国产精品野战在线观看 ?

      “華北克拉通破壞”重大研究計劃共享數(shù)據(jù)庫系統(tǒng)設計*

      2013-03-14 06:18:26姚志祥歐陽飚吳建平鄭秀芬
      地震科學進展 2013年9期
      關(guān)鍵詞:克拉通數(shù)據(jù)庫系統(tǒng)華北

      姚志祥 歐陽飚 吳建平 鄭秀芬 黃 靜 黎 明

      1)中國地震局地球物理研究所,北京100081

      2)中國地震局地質(zhì)研究所,北京100029

      (作者電子信箱,姚志祥:qdocyao@126.com)

      引言

      “華北克拉通破壞”重大科學研究計劃通過資助流動臺陣地震觀測和人工源地震探測剖面,以及與克拉通破壞相關(guān)的地質(zhì)和地球化學觀測等項目,開展對華北克拉通破壞有關(guān)的核心科學問題進行多學科研究[1-2]。在該計劃實施過程中,產(chǎn)生了大量的包括天然地震、人工探測等類型的地球科學觀測數(shù)據(jù),這些地球科學數(shù)據(jù)是認識華北克拉通形成、演化理論的基礎與根據(jù)。因此,自然基金委借鑒國際上重大研究計劃建立相應數(shù)據(jù)中心的經(jīng)驗,在該計劃開始之初提出建立共享數(shù)據(jù)庫系統(tǒng),安全科學地管理這些寶貴的數(shù)據(jù)[1]。通過共享數(shù)據(jù)庫系統(tǒng)的建立,實現(xiàn)數(shù)據(jù)的共享,讓科研人員充分挖掘與應用其中蘊藏的大量信息,開展多學科科學研究[3]。

      近年來,隨著大型數(shù)據(jù)庫技術(shù)、Web-GIS技術(shù)以及計算機網(wǎng)絡技術(shù)的發(fā)展,為數(shù)據(jù)庫建設和數(shù)據(jù)共享提供了更加安全、有效、快捷的技術(shù)支撐。如GIS技術(shù)對具有空間屬性的數(shù)據(jù)圖形化表達,可以為用戶提供更優(yōu)質(zhì)的服務,在數(shù)據(jù)庫設計時可以充分利用相關(guān)技術(shù)[4-6]。另外,大型存儲等設備的更新?lián)Q代,也為海量數(shù)據(jù)的集中管理和服務提供了更好的條件。但數(shù)據(jù)量的增長對數(shù)據(jù)庫系統(tǒng)和數(shù)據(jù)服務都提出更高的要求,因此,充分利用先進技術(shù)進行合理的數(shù)據(jù)庫系統(tǒng)設計極其重要。

      1 數(shù)據(jù)結(jié)構(gòu)與建庫

      在“華北克拉通破壞”重大研究計劃支持的觀測項目中,有流動臺陣地震觀測、人工地震探測、地質(zhì)和地球化學等觀測研究 ,數(shù)據(jù)類別繁多,數(shù)據(jù)量大,其中流動臺陣地震觀測數(shù)據(jù)量最大,數(shù)據(jù)量達到幾個TB。因此,需要根據(jù)不同種類數(shù)據(jù)及其結(jié)構(gòu)特點進行劃分,按照相關(guān)專業(yè)規(guī)范建立相應的數(shù)據(jù)庫。一般而言,根據(jù)數(shù)據(jù)結(jié)構(gòu)特征可以把數(shù)據(jù)分為結(jié)構(gòu)化數(shù)據(jù)和非結(jié)構(gòu)化數(shù)據(jù),結(jié)構(gòu)化數(shù)據(jù)是數(shù)據(jù)之間具有一定的關(guān)系和條理性的數(shù)據(jù)體,可以用標準化的數(shù)據(jù)庫表進行管理。如天然地震數(shù)據(jù)中臺站、通道、儀器響應等信息數(shù)據(jù),需要根據(jù)國際標準交換格式SEED 建立庫表;人工探測數(shù)據(jù)的觀測點、炮點等信息數(shù)據(jù)需要根據(jù)國際SEGY 格式相關(guān)要求建立數(shù)據(jù)庫結(jié)構(gòu),而涉及的地質(zhì)、地球化學等巖石采樣及測定數(shù)據(jù)根據(jù)相關(guān)標準建立結(jié)構(gòu)化的數(shù)據(jù)庫。非結(jié)構(gòu)化數(shù)據(jù)是指不能夠用關(guān)系數(shù)據(jù)庫結(jié)構(gòu)進行分類描述的數(shù)據(jù),主要包括文檔資料數(shù)據(jù)和一般數(shù)據(jù)表格文檔數(shù)據(jù),對可以通過提取關(guān)系屬性信息進行結(jié)構(gòu)化的管理的數(shù)據(jù),形成結(jié)構(gòu)化的數(shù)據(jù)或索引,對于無法提取關(guān)系結(jié)構(gòu)的部分數(shù)據(jù)使用文檔庫進行管理。其中數(shù)據(jù)量最大的天然地震觀測數(shù)據(jù)以及人工探測數(shù)據(jù)的地震波形數(shù)據(jù)體,采用了標準格式的文件系統(tǒng)進行管理和存儲,通過結(jié)構(gòu)化的索引進行管理。

      2 系統(tǒng)架構(gòu)設計

      依據(jù)“華北克拉通破壞”重大研究計劃共享數(shù)據(jù)庫系統(tǒng)在數(shù)據(jù)建模、數(shù)據(jù)匯集、數(shù)據(jù)分析處理與產(chǎn)品生成、數(shù)據(jù)圖形化展示及GIS導航、數(shù)據(jù)共享、數(shù)據(jù)管理、數(shù)據(jù)存儲備份、門戶網(wǎng)站、用戶管理與權(quán)限認證等方面的功能需求,采用Oracle大型數(shù)據(jù)庫技術(shù),結(jié)合新的GIS技術(shù)對整個數(shù)據(jù)庫系統(tǒng)進行了架構(gòu)設計。

      2.1 系統(tǒng)架構(gòu)

      設計的“華北克拉通破壞”重大研究計劃共享數(shù)據(jù)庫系統(tǒng)整體架構(gòu)由“一個數(shù)據(jù)庫、一個門戶、兩個系統(tǒng)支撐平臺、四個專業(yè)應用”構(gòu)成(圖1)。一個數(shù)據(jù)庫包括采取獨立數(shù)據(jù)庫、獨立用戶、獨立表空間的方式管理的四類數(shù)據(jù),主要有地震數(shù)據(jù)(包括天然地震和人工探測數(shù)據(jù))、地質(zhì)數(shù)據(jù)、地球化學數(shù)據(jù)和系統(tǒng)支撐數(shù)據(jù),這些專業(yè)數(shù)據(jù)、用戶與權(quán)限以及系統(tǒng)運行所需要的支撐數(shù)據(jù)通過數(shù)據(jù)庫進行系統(tǒng)管理。經(jīng)專業(yè)應用、數(shù)據(jù)交換與共享應用、GIS地理信息系統(tǒng)應用、數(shù)據(jù)有效性保障應用四個專業(yè)應用,在系統(tǒng)權(quán)限管理平臺和系統(tǒng)運營管理平臺兩個系統(tǒng)支撐平臺支撐下保證共享數(shù)據(jù)系統(tǒng)門戶的運行。

      圖1 系統(tǒng)整體架構(gòu)示意圖

      2.2 系統(tǒng)功能模塊

      根據(jù)系統(tǒng)架構(gòu)設計,共享數(shù)據(jù)庫系統(tǒng)功能從邏輯上可以分為系統(tǒng)支撐功能部分、地震等相關(guān)數(shù)據(jù)管理功能部分、用戶及權(quán)限管理功能部分、有關(guān)數(shù)據(jù)共享的應用及接口處理部分以及附屬工具,各功能部分承擔不同的系統(tǒng)任務(圖2)。根據(jù)具體承擔的任務劃分,功能模塊主要包括系統(tǒng)管理、數(shù)據(jù)管理、權(quán)限管理、數(shù)據(jù)共享、Web GIS、信息發(fā)布等主體模塊,這些主體模塊由若干程序模塊組成,程序模塊又由若干一級、二級程序子模塊組成,分別完成各自獨立的功能。如數(shù)據(jù)共享模塊包括流動臺、固定臺的連續(xù)波形和事件波形數(shù)據(jù)共享服務、人工地震探測數(shù)據(jù)、地質(zhì)與地球化學數(shù)據(jù)共享服務,及其有關(guān)的數(shù)據(jù)處理格式轉(zhuǎn)換等程序子模塊。共享數(shù)據(jù)庫系統(tǒng)共設計有18個程序模塊,47個一級子程序模塊和50個二級子程序模塊。

      圖2 系統(tǒng)功能邏輯模塊基本構(gòu)成圖

      3 系統(tǒng)開發(fā)技術(shù)體系

      “華北克拉通破壞”重大研究計劃共享數(shù)據(jù)庫系統(tǒng)是對海量觀測數(shù)據(jù)進行管理和業(yè)務應用的綜合性平臺,考慮到系統(tǒng)的高開放性和高可維護性,系統(tǒng)采用成熟的B/S(Browser/Server)結(jié)構(gòu),嚴格遵循J2EE 的MVC(模型層(model)、視圖層(view)、控制器層(Controller))三層架構(gòu)模式(如圖3)。在數(shù)據(jù)庫技術(shù)方面,考慮到系統(tǒng)將面對海量數(shù)據(jù)的處理及對數(shù)據(jù)高安全性的要求,系統(tǒng)選用大型Oracle數(shù)據(jù)庫技術(shù)。應用服務技術(shù)方面,根據(jù)系統(tǒng)運行時的系統(tǒng)負載、運行效率和跨平臺性等方面實際需求,系統(tǒng)選用Java語言及部分基于Java語言的成熟程序開發(fā)框架作為系統(tǒng)后臺程序的開發(fā)基礎。同時,針對具有空間特性的數(shù)據(jù),開發(fā)基于Flex技術(shù)的Web GIS 可視化應用,部分子模塊采用GIS地圖操作觸發(fā)的方式進行數(shù)據(jù)管理和系統(tǒng)應用。在客戶端技術(shù)方面,系統(tǒng)采用先進的RIA(Rich Internet Application)的理念及相關(guān)成熟可靠的Flex 等開發(fā)技術(shù),使表現(xiàn)力、通信與網(wǎng)絡效率和交互性更強。

      圖3 程序開發(fā)設計架構(gòu)圖

      4 結(jié)語

      針對“華北克拉通破壞”重大研究計劃有關(guān)觀測數(shù)據(jù)的類型和特點,結(jié)合在數(shù)據(jù)管理和共享以及系統(tǒng)整體性能方面的實際需求,對共享數(shù)據(jù)庫系統(tǒng)進行了整體設計。系統(tǒng)設計充分利用了大型Oracle數(shù)據(jù)庫和Arc GIS等計算機新技術(shù),通過對數(shù)據(jù)庫層、系統(tǒng)與專應用層合理設計,采用成熟的B/S結(jié)構(gòu)和J2EE的MVC 三層架構(gòu)模式,結(jié)合Flex和RIA 新技術(shù)和理念,選用Java語言進行開發(fā)。這些計算機新技術(shù)的應用,保證了已建成的共享數(shù)據(jù)庫系統(tǒng)數(shù)據(jù)管理和共享服務功能的實現(xiàn),同時系統(tǒng)具有高開放性和高可維護性,客戶端方面表現(xiàn)力、交互性、以及便捷性更好。

      [1]國家自然科學基金委員會.國家自然科學基金《華北克拉通破壞》重大研究計劃2007年項目申請指南.2007

      [2]朱日祥,徐義剛,朱光,等.華北克拉通破壞.中國科學:地球科學,2012,42(8):1135-1159

      [3]孫樞.地球數(shù)據(jù)是地球科學創(chuàng)新的重要源泉—從地球科學談科學數(shù)據(jù)共享.中國基礎科學,2003(1):19-23

      [4]王卷樂,游松財,謝傳節(jié),等.面向Web的地學數(shù)據(jù)共享服務平臺架構(gòu)設計.地球信息科學,2004,6(4):62-65

      [5]郭騰云,陳小鋼,吳紹洪,等.基于Web GIS的空間數(shù)據(jù)共享解決方案.科技導報,2004(3):17-20

      [6]歐少佳,許惠平,陳華根,等.中國巖石圈數(shù)據(jù)模型總體設計.地球?qū)W報,2005,26(3):265-270

      猜你喜歡
      克拉通數(shù)據(jù)庫系統(tǒng)華北
      巖石圈地幔分層性對克拉通穩(wěn)定性的影響
      華北玉米市場將進入筑底期
      有關(guān)克拉通破壞及其成因的綜述
      數(shù)據(jù)庫系統(tǒng)shell腳本應用
      電子測試(2018年14期)2018-09-26 06:04:24
      微細銑削工藝數(shù)據(jù)庫系統(tǒng)設計與開發(fā)
      華北克拉通重力剖面重力點位GPS測量精度分析
      Literature Review on Context Translation Mode
      實時數(shù)據(jù)庫系統(tǒng)數(shù)據(jù)安全采集方案
      電信科學(2016年10期)2016-11-23 05:12:00
      拉張槽對四川盆地海相油氣分布的控制作用
      核反應堆材料數(shù)據(jù)庫系統(tǒng)及其應用
      刚察县| 肥东县| 信阳市| 广安市| 城步| 阜宁县| 蕲春县| 巫溪县| 岑巩县| 安陆市| 兴山县| 黔西县| 揭东县| 当阳市| 曲沃县| 天台县| 富顺县| 泸定县| 顺义区| 泽州县| 东城区| 昌江| 大姚县| 滨州市| 钦州市| 西安市| 井研县| 迭部县| 云梦县| 夏河县| 西乌珠穆沁旗| 延津县| 南靖县| 克拉玛依市| 阳朔县| 济源市| 定南县| 哈巴河县| 隆回县| 革吉县| 石城县|